## Runbook: Nightly Inventory Reconciliation (Stockmere)

The reconciliation job compares warehouse counts in Stockmere against the ledger in Tallyfox and writes discrepancies to the variance table. It runs at 02:30 and usually finishes in twenty minutes. If it stalls, kill the worker and rerun with the --resume flag; it is idempotent. As a contractor you won't have personal credentials yet, so authenticate the rerun with the shared job account. Its key is below.

app token of bahaf-tajeg = zpat23_SjjsllwiLmXbtS65veZaV47

## Tuning the contrast audit

A note before you touch anything: Tintcheck's scoring isn't magic, it's just ratios plus a few fudge factors we argued about for weeks. The scanner samples rendered pixels rather than trusting CSS, so anti-aliasing makes edge pixels noisy — that's why there's a tolerance band instead of a hard cutoff. Large-text detection uses computed size and weight together. If you tighten anything, rerun the fixture suite first; false positives annoy designers fast. The current thresholds live right here.

tuning table, bagep-tahof:
RATE_LIMITS = {
    "ralael": 10,
    "druath": 5,
}

## Changed Defaults — Glyphcart 4.2

Third-party fonts are now vendored into the build instead of fetched at runtime. The remote font CDN fallback is disabled by default; offline builds no longer stall on font resolution. Maintainers updating font sets must re-run the vendoring script. The new default configuration shipped with this release is as follows.

deployment values, yadup-kadug:
[sorys]
port = 5672
team = noveth
host = sorys.orvexcorp.example
region = south-4
access_code = ac_deddc1
timeout_ms = 1500

// Encoding sniff order for uploads in Textgrove: BOM check, then
// UTF-8 strict decode, then the charmap heuristic. Latin-1 fallback
// fires only if confidence < 0.6. Do not reorder; the Kelvane import
// regression came from exactly that. Threshold below was tuned on
// the Orvik corpus. Verified against the build below.

trace token, kahog-tajeg: htk6_97d963